For a while the overpriced tuner company TLC4x4 kept pitching ideas to TMC about where the new Land Cruiser should go.

They even built a working 21st century FJ40 prototype that was a Taco-derived soft top Jeep Wrangler competitor and pitched it to Toyota, who quickly shot the idea down and decided Americans wanted something like the effeminate FJ Cruiser more.

The FJ40 LWB was another of their creations made in the late 90s, off an 80 series I believe. Toyota also decided that this was no good, and decided to further bloat and Range Rover-ify their American market Land Cruisers.

TLC4x4 has since decided they're better off selling egregiously priced restored Land Cruisers with GM truck running gear and hand built, licensed 40 series updates (as well as Willys and Bronco) under their Icon brand.

The FJ Runner was a SEMA exclusive (hell knows who made it, but based on the terrible rebar roof rack it looks amateurish as hell) where they tried to take the FJ's funky styling and graft it on a 4th gen runner--so you have useful windows and doors, but still keep the weird grille. It was purely cosmetic, but hinted that the 4x4 stuff from the FJC can be put on a 4Runner. Not long after, they did just that with TE which emerged from the 5th gen family. They went even further with the luxo running gear exclusive to the Limited. Toyota did well to distinguish the TE from other 4Runners, but decided not to go balls out like the FJ Runner concept with truly unique styling.

A 21st century Iron Pig 4x4 emerging from the 4Runner would be cool, with round headlights and all, but if one thing is certain about Toyota is that they've fully embraced the boring as hell and conservative design mantra--and getting them to deviate from it is hard.
